Output d996d42f7f90c3bfd3aad3ed63aabe393b077031f68414e158facfb0973e816b:0

value
86252588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8553c144d481817173ba20a95e316f39edc865d2 OP_EQUAL
address
3Dqz8TGAHKxekh4sUoS7x7gLboYkjXppjH
transaction
d996d42f7f90c3bfd3aad3ed63aabe393b077031f68414e158facfb0973e816b